This role will focus on managing the engineering work packages and tasks in order to meet the overall program and business objectives for the NH90 program. It involves managing day-to-day activities of the several disciplines within the Design Built Support Team including Designers, Analysis Engineers, System Engineers, Qualification Engineers and others.
The team is responsible for the development, qualification and production of structure components for NH90 helicopter, in both Army (TTH, or Tactical Transport Helicopter) and Navy (NFH, or NATO Frigate Helicopter) versions, which are developed under GKN Fokker responsibility.
The Engineering Team Lead will support the Chief Engineer with operationally and technically managing the Functional Team Leads and, if the Functional Team Lead is not available, the allocated engineers of the Design Built Support Team. The ETL reports hierarchically to the FOKKER-NH90 Chief Engineer and operationally to the FOKKER-NH90 Chief Engineer and Program Manager. The team is located in Papendrecht offices.
